A hydraulic uncoiler is a machine used in metalworking industries to efficiently uncoil and feed metal coils into processing equipment.
How Does a Hydraulic Uncoiler Work?
The hydraulic uncoiler operates by using hydraulic power to smoothly unwind the metal coil and control the feeding speed.
Benefits of Using a Hydraulic Uncoiler
One major benefit of using a hydraulic uncoiler is its ability to improve productivity and streamline the metalworking process.
Types of Hydraulic Uncoilers
There are various types of hydraulic uncoilers available, including single mandrel, double mandrel, and motorized uncoilers.
Features to Look for in a Hydraulic Uncoiler
When choosing a hydraulic uncoiler, important features to consider include coil weight capacity, speed control, and automatic tension adjustment.
Common Applications of Hydraulic Uncoilers
Hydraulic uncoilers are commonly used in industries such as automotive manufacturing, steel fabrication, and metal stamping.
Maintenance Tips for Hydraulic Uncoilers
To ensure optimal performance, regular maintenance of hydraulic uncoilers is essential, including lubrication and inspection of hydraulic components.
Factors to Consider When Choosing a Hydraulic Uncoiler
When selecting a hydraulic uncoiler, factors to consider include the thickness and width of the metal coils to be processed, as well as the required feeding speed.
How to Safely Operate a Hydraulic Uncoiler
Safety is paramount when operating a hydraulic uncoiler, so it is important to follow proper operating procedures and use appropriate personal protective equipment.
